Output 3de35564d99398c5a84a81969ac68ea5c2dba2d52c4dec9e77e4f8540dac146b:437

value
587714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63cc7af2f36f4273304e3d2b30f9a9becf5ee1d OP_EQUAL
address
3MDoLfXYmscTgC7y4uu2JrQH13a5eWJ7S8
transaction
3de35564d99398c5a84a81969ac68ea5c2dba2d52c4dec9e77e4f8540dac146b
spent
true